Understanding Electric Bike Batteries

You’ll be amazed at how long you can ride on a single charge with the powerful batteries found in electric bikes. Electric bike batteries have come a long way in terms of technology and efficiency.

The battery lifespan of an electric bike can vary depending on factors such as the quality of the battery and how it is maintained. On average, a good quality electric bike battery can last anywhere from 500 to 1,000 charge cycles.

Charging time is another important factor to consider. Most electric bike batteries can be fully charged within 3 to 6 hours, depending on the charger and battery capacity.

It’s important to note that factors such as terrain, rider weight, and speed can also affect the range of an electric bike. These factors will be discussed further in the subsequent section about factors affecting electric bike range.

Terrain and Elevation

Navigating different types of terrain and elevations can significantly impact how long your ride will last on an electric bike. Here are three ways that terrain and elevation challenges can affect your battery life:

  1. Uphill climbs: When riding uphill, the motor has to work harder to overcome the increased resistance. This puts more strain on the battery, causing it to drain faster.

  2. Downhill descents: Going downhill might seem like a breeze, but the motor still needs to assist in maintaining a steady speed. In this case, the battery is used to regulate the motor’s power output, which can also decrease its overall lifespan.

  3. Off-road trails: Riding on rough terrain with bumps, rocks, and uneven surfaces requires more power to maintain stability and control. This extra effort can drain the battery quicker than riding on smooth roads.

Considering these elevation challenges, it’s important to be mindful of how terrain can impact your electric bike’s battery life.

Weather Conditions

Weather conditions can be a game-changer when it comes to the performance and enjoyment of your electric bike ride. Riding in the rain can significantly affect the distance your electric bike can go. Wet roads increase rolling resistance, making it harder for the bike to move forward, and this can reduce your range. Additionally, rain can damage the electrical components of your bike if they’re not properly protected.

On the other hand, wind can either be your friend or your foe. A tailwind can provide a nice boost, allowing you to cover more ground with less effort. However, a headwind can be quite challenging, as it creates resistance that can drain your battery faster.

So, it’s important to consider weather conditions before embarking on your electric bike adventure.

Types of Electric Bike Motors

When it comes to electric bike motors, you’ll be amazed at how far they can take you. Electric bike motor efficiency plays a crucial role in determining the range of an electric bike.

There are different types of electric bike motors, each with its own benefits. The most common types are hub motors and mid-drive motors. Hub motors are located in the wheel hub and provide a smooth and quiet ride. They are also easier to maintain and have a higher top speed.

On the other hand, mid-drive motors are located near the bottom bracket and provide better balance and handling. They also offer more torque, making them suitable for hilly terrains. Understanding the benefits of different motor types can help you choose the right electric bike for your needs.

Maintaining and Maximizing Your Electric Bike’s Range

Maintaining and maximizing your e-bike’s range can be a real test of endurance, as you navigate the treacherous terrain of battery life. Battery maintenance is crucial to ensure optimum performance and longevity. Here are some charging tips to help you get the most out of your electric bike:

  1. Charge Regularly: It is recommended to charge your e-bike after every ride, regardless of the battery level. This practice helps prevent deep discharges, which can negatively impact battery life.

  2. Avoid Extreme Temperatures: Extreme heat or cold can reduce battery performance. Store and charge your e-bike in a moderate temperature environment.

  3. Optimize Charging Time: Charge your battery to around 80% for daily rides. Fully charging to 100% occasionally can help balance the cells, improving overall battery health.

By following these battery maintenance and charging tips, you can extend your e-bike’s range and enjoy longer rides. Now, let’s delve into real-life stories and experiences with long electric bike rides.

How long does it take to charge an electric bike battery?

Charging time for an electric bike battery varies depending on the model and charger used. On average, it takes around 4-6 hours to fully charge a battery. It’s important to note that frequent fast charging may reduce the overall battery lifespan.
